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ost In Yellow Springs, OH
The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al in Yellow Springs, OH can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ees. We’ll work with you to develop a plan to address the issue and get your home back to normal.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Root removal and pipe repair |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area, the severity of the damage, and the type of pipe material. |
| Tree root removal and pipe replacement | $2,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the severity of the damage, and the type of pipe material. |
| Water damage repair and restoration | $1,000 – $3,000 | The size of the affected area, the severity of the damage, and the type of materials used for repair. |
| Final inspection and testing |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the job and the number of inspections required. |
